This subject covers recent advances in the application of genetics and breeding technologies to commercial animal improvement programs including: advanced reproductive technologies, quantitative and molecular genetics. Students will develop the skills to evaluate the potential impact of recent breeding technologies on breeding program design. Practical sessions aim to develop skills in the interpretation of genetic data and to gain knowledge of how reproductive systems can be manipulated to implement advanced breeding technologies, such as multiple ovulation and embryo transfer, cloning and transgenesis.
